WebA dishwasher installation lacking an air gap will always be at risk of backflow, even with a code-compliant high loop. That risk may be small, but "perfect storms" can and do happen. The only way to isolate the dishwasher from contamination is to use an air gap. WebThe air gap can be found on the top of the sink usually next to your faucet and is used as a backflow prevention device for your dishwasher. If water is flowing from your air gap device there is most likely a clog within the device that needs attending to. WebAug 2, 2024 · Backflow from a clogged sink into a dishwasher won’t run back into the supply line, but can flood the dishwasher with dirty water. A dishwasher might contain a simple flapper valve in the drain outlet. If water flows back, water pressure seals the valve.
